[QUOTE="HardRightEdge, post: 517328"] And yet Pickett takes nearly every snap in the base D and continues to stay healthy. I don't know his snap count, but it's probably in the 20's per game as base-only player, and has been for a few years. That's not a lot of wear and tear. Of the names you mentioned, only Raji and Boyd are NT types, and that assumes Boyd can put on more bulk. Raji has already been discusses as possibly a poor value given what others might offer him, and Boyd hasn't seen the field. Has he even been game day active yet? I don't know Pickett's personal view on the matter, but I've not heard him declare this is his last season. I have no reason to believe he won't want to play, and no reason to believe he doesn't have another good season in him. Then there's Jolly. We can keep both Pickett and Jolly for a lot less money than Raji by himself. I'd go with that pending what happens the rest of the season. [/QUOTE]
